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best lakes for swimming near Lermoos?

For swimming, the Eibsee is highly recommended, known for its refreshing water, typically 20-22°C, and small pebble bays on its northern shore. The Blindsee also offers crystal-clear turquoise water and a freely accessible natural bathing area with stone beaches. Heiterwanger See and Mittersee are also popular for their clear waters and inviting conditions.

Are there family-friendly lakes around Lermoos?

Yes, several lakes are great for families. The Eibsee has paths around it that are easy to walk, even with children, and offers various activities like pedal boats and stand-up paddleboards. Heiterwanger See is also very family-friendly, with options for swimming, boating, and scenic trails along its shores.

Can I take a boat tour on any of the lakes?

Yes, you can enjoy boat tours on Heiterwanger See. The MS Margarethe and MS Wilhelm offer tours that connect Heiterwanger See with the Plansee between May and October, allowing you to experience the fjord-like landscape from the water. At the Eibsee, you can rent pedal boats, rowing boats, and stand-up paddleboards, or take an electric boat tour with views of the Wetterstein Mountains and Zugspitze.

Are there any facilities or places to eat near the lakes?

Yes, some lakes have facilities. Near Lake Seebensee, you'll find the Coburger Hut, which offers great food and a very nice view over the lake. The Eibsee also has facilities, including options for renting boats and places to eat near the Eibsee Hotel.

Are there any lakes suitable for diving or snorkeling?

Yes, Blindsee is particularly popular among divers and snorkelers due to its crystal-clear turquoise water and mysterious underwater world. Its rare beauty and impressive panoramic views also make it a unique spot for underwater exploration.

What makes Heiterwanger See a unique lake in the region?

Heiterwanger See is often called a 'decathlete' among the region's lakes because of the wide variety of activities it offers. Its clear, turquoise waters are perfect for swimming, boating, fishing, and stand-up paddleboarding. Additionally, it features scenic trails for hikers, runners, and cyclists, and offers boat tours connecting it to the Plansee, showcasing its stunning fjord-like landscape.
